Understand Your Right to Compensation in Texas

"Slip and Fall" is a basic term used to describe accidents, and the subsequent injuries, caused by a hazardous condition on the property of another. The property owner in Pharr may be accountable for your injuries on their property.

Frequent Reasons for Slip and Falls in Pharr Texas

Slip and Falls occur because of a hazardous or dangerous condition on the property in Texas.

These conditions are classified loosely into three categories: 1) structural defects occurring as buildings get older and need repair, 2) hazards created by weather, like icy sidewalks, and 3) building code violations where a property owner has not taken reasonable steps to ensure that the property meets all local safety requirements.

The type of evidence you will need to show to prove your injury may depend on what type of Slip and Fall case you have in Pharr.
